Description

Lubricating oil sampling equipment
Technical Field
The utility model relates to the technical field of detection equipment, in particular to lubricating oil sampling equipment.
Background
Lubricating oil is a liquid or semisolid lubricant used on various types of mechanical equipment to reduce friction and protect machinery and workpieces, and mainly plays roles of lubrication, auxiliary cooling, rust prevention, cleaning, sealing, buffering and the like. With the rapid development of national economy and the continuous improvement of equipment management level, the quality requirements of equipment 'blood' -lubricating oil, which provides guarantee for the reliable operation of equipment, are higher and higher, so that the detection of the lubricating oil is more and more important. At present, most lubricating oil sampling device, including the oil storage tank, the sampling bottle, sampling tube and evacuation container, the one end of sampling tube and the oil discharge port intercommunication of oil storage tank, the other end of sampling tube sets up in the sampling bottle after passing evacuation container, its sample position of current sampling equipment when using is fixed, the sample scope is little, the result accuracy that leads to the sample is low, if will improve and detect the precision, need take a sample to different positions many times, the availability factor is low, the intensity of labour of workman has been increased.
SUMMERY OF THE UTILITY MODEL
In view of the above situation, in order to overcome the defects of the prior art, the present invention provides a lubricating oil sampling device, which can improve the sampling range of an oil sample, thereby improving the accuracy of an oil sample detection result.

2. Lubricating oil sampling device according to claim 1, characterised in that the sampling tube (8) is arranged non-collinear with the axis of the mounting rod (5) and the outlet tube (2) is arranged non-collinear with the axis of the mounting rod (5).
3. The lubricating oil sampling device of claim 1, wherein the driving assembly comprises a connector (10), the connector (10) is rotationally sealed with the mounting rod (5), the sampling tube (8) is communicated with the mounting rod (5) through the connector (10), and one end of the connector (10) departing from the mounting rod (5) is in a closed state.
4. The lubricating oil sampling device according to claim 3, wherein a rotating rod (12) which is coaxial with the mounting rod (5) is arranged inside the mounting rod (5), one end of the rotating rod (12) is fixedly connected with the connector (10), one end of the rotating rod (12), which is far away from the connector (10), extends out of the mounting rod (5), and the rotating rod (12) and the mounting rod (5) are rotationally sealed.
5. The lubricating oil sampling device according to claim 4, characterized in that the end of the mounting rod (5) far away from the connector (10) is provided with a driving motor (3), and the output end of the driving motor (3) is connected with the rotating rod (12).
6. The lubricating oil sampling device according to claim 3, wherein the sampling pipe (8) is rotatably mounted on the connector (10), the connector (10) is rotatably mounted with a connecting rod (7), the mounting rod (5) is provided with threads and the mounting rod (5) is provided with a nut (6) in threaded fit, and one end of the connecting rod (7) far away from the sampling pipe (8) is rotatably connected with the nut (6).
7. A device for sampling lubricating oil according to claim 3, characterised in that the sample tube (8) communicates with the connection head (10) via a bellows.
